The Resource A picture book of Rosa Parks, David A. Adler ; illustrated by Robert Casilla
A picture book of Rosa Parks, David A. Adler ; illustrated by Robert Casilla
- Summary
- A biography of the Alabama black woman whose refusal to give up her seat on a bus helped establish the civil rights movement
